Output bc13684db66317e68f85d499538fc7bd2e59c072c5e03f306caa65134379e614:3

value
3417213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1272a68945bacb6f1c3ea43da954b0b0185d2f OP_EQUAL
address
34AAGW6ioDjmTNM4WcyWr3xdQUs4EeZUuT
transaction
bc13684db66317e68f85d499538fc7bd2e59c072c5e03f306caa65134379e614
spent
true